Lemon Squares

Crumbly buttery bottom with a lemon custardy topping. Soo sweet, soo lemony, a taste of sunshine in a bite! (I adapted this recipe from the formidable Pioneer Woman.)


Level: Easy

Serves: 18

Prep: 15 min

Cook: 45 minutes


Ingredients:


Dough:

250g flour

100g sugar

½ tsp salt

225g cold butter


Filling:

300g sugar

35g flour

5 eggs

4 lemon – juice and zest

Powder sugar – for decorating


Preparation:


Preheat the oven on 175C. Butter a 23cm x 33 cm baking pan.


Mix together the flour, sugar and the salt. Cut the butter into 1 cm cubes and incorporate it into the flout with a pastry cutter until it resembles fine crumbs. Pres it into the buttered pan and bake it for 20 minutes.


For the filling, mix together all the ingredients until smooth, pour it over the baked crust and bake it for another 25 minutes.


Let it cool completely, then put it in the fridge for 2 hours. Sift powder sugar on top, cut into squares and enjoy!
